PRACTICAL TIPS FOR WRITING A SIMPLE FRESHER RESUME FORMAT
Keep it neat and one-page long. Hiring managers appreciate resumes that are easy to scan.
Use a clear objective statement. This gives direction to your resume and shows your motivation.
Highlight internships and projects. Even short stints count as experience when presented well.
Stick to bullet points. Avoid big paragraphs — clarity is key.
Tailor your resume to each job. A generic resume won’t get noticed; tweak it to match the role.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S ABOUT SIMPLE FRESHER RESUME FORMAT
1. What should I write in the objective section of a fresher resume?
Use the objective to express your career goals, enthusiasm to learn, and how you plan to contribute to the company.
2. Can I add hobbies and interests to a fresher resume?
Yes, especially if your hobbies reflect soft skills or creative abilities relevant to the job — like writing, design, or leadership.
3. Should I include certifications in a fresher resume?
Absolutely. Certifications (online or offline) show initiative and skill development, which are valued even in entry-level roles.
4. How do I list internships if they were short-term?
List them as you would any job, mentioning the company, duration, and your responsibilities. Focus on what you learned and contributed.
